In a flurry of activity bolstering their pass rush, the Seahawks signed Carlos Dunlap, Benson Mayowa, and Kerry Hyder in a 48-hour span. But these aggressive moves came at a cost, as the team had to cut Jarran Reed to fit the contracts under the salary cap. Hosts Corbin Smith and Rob Rang discuss why Seattle is well-positioned to move forward without Reed, investigate the team's decision to bring back Al Woods to help fill the void, and break down two listener submissions for "Mock Draft Monday."
